Turn Shopify order exports into auditable vendor statements.
Upload a Shopify Orders CSV, vendor payout rules, and optional manual adjustments. The alpha calculates vendor balances, flags ambiguous refunds and missing rules, then creates a lockable payout batch with a SHA-256 manifest.
Alpha limitation: Shopify's standard order CSV exposes the order's total refunded amount, but not always the exact refunded line-item allocation. Single-vendor refunds can be handled automatically. Multi-vendor refunded orders are proportionally estimated and always flagged for review. A production app would use Shopify's Refund API for exact allocation.
